Problem running AR scene in Unity 2020 - No active XR Subsystem errors

I successfully built a very simple AR scene in Unity 2019 and built it to Android. However trying to replicate my project on Unity 2020.3.10f or 2020.3.15f is causing me issues (below).
My basic setup is:

  • Open a new scene

  • File > Build Settings > Android > add scene and switch platform

  • Install latest verified AR Foundation (4.1.7) & ARCore XR Plugin (4.1.7)

  • Project Settings > XR Plugin Management > Android> Check "Initialize XR on StartUp" & "ARCore"

  • Delete Main Camera

  • Add AR Session & AR Session Origin to the scene

Normally now in 2019, if hit Play it would work. But in 2020, I hit play, the viewport is black, and I am getting the following errors:

 No active UnityEngine.XR.ARSubsystems.XRSessionSubsystem is available. Please ensure that a valid loader configuration exists in the XR project settings.
 
 UnityEngine.XR.ARFoundation.ARSession:OnEnable () (at Library/PackageCache/com.unity.xr.arfoundation@4.1.7/Runtime/AR/ARSession.cs:341)
 
 No active UnityEngine.XR.ARSubsystems.XRCameraSubsystem is available. Please ensure that a valid loader configuration exists in the XR project settings.
 
 UnityEngine.XR.ARFoundation.SubsystemLifecycleManager`3<UnityEngine.XR.ARSubsystems.XRCameraSubsystem, UnityEngine.XR.ARSubsystems.XRCameraSubsystemDescriptor, UnityEngine.XR.ARSubsystems.XRCameraSubsystem/Provider>:OnEnable () (at Library/PackageCache/com.unity.xr.arfoundation@4.1.7/Runtime/AR/SubsystemLifecycleManager.cs:87)

 No active UnityEngine.XR.XRInputSubsystem is available. Please ensure that a valid loader configuration exists in the XR project settings.
 
 UnityEngine.XR.ARFoundation.ARInputManager:OnEnable () (at Library/PackageCache/com.unity.xr.arfoundation@4.1.7/Runtime/AR/ARInputManager.cs:24)
 


I've searched far and wide, and all the forum posts I can find just say to make sure to check the boxes in XR Plugin Management, but this is done and it makes no difference.

I can replicate the same error on two separate machines.
